World Vision International (WVI) is currently seeking applications from the eligible applicants for the post of Senior Finance Officer in Amman, Jordan.
The Senior Finance Officer will provide technical backstopping to program teams, promoting adherence to World Vision’s Field Finance Manual for a host of routine financial transactions.
WVI’s mission is to promote human transformation, seek justice and bear witness to the good news of the Kingdom of God.
Key Jobs Responsibilities
The Senior Finance Officer will perform the following functions-
- Ensure the performance management is practiced within the unit to enhance performance smooth staff relation and accountability.
- Ensure that all financial transactions have relevant backup documentation, corresponding to WVI and donor regulations.
- Deal with project specific Cash and Bank Books.
- Provide technical back-stopping to implementing partners, providing on-the-job mentoring of World Vision finance requirements.
- Train the project(s) local partner organizations in financial reporting according to WVG and donors, guidelines and requirements.
- Make sure that all BS and IS accounts relating to the project are reconciled on a monthly basis.
- Work closely with Project Manager/Response Manager on donor compliance issues and procedures, advice on possible disallowed costs, budget amendment(s).
- Advise and make relevant projections of the expenditures taking into the consideration the burn-rate and exchange rate issues.
- Assist Finance Manager in designing, implementing and maintaining systems of internal controls in order to provide appropriate levels of security over the organizations. Resources and operation.
- Prepare/review coding on financial vouchers for valid account/cost center and donor combinations, review source documents and enter financial data into Subsystems as required. Actively follow-up on any issues identified in the FFR reviews.
- Monitoring local bank account balances.
- Coordinate the implementation of LDR with field teams, providing technical back-stopping and tracking submissions, following up with staff to ensure timely monthly implementation.
- Work closely with external and internal auditors on interim and final audits (provide required documentation, coordinate explanations as required, etc.), – prepare interim ’desk audits’ of Local Partner in-countries.
